Wise0wl · 29/03/2024 21:24

Hey @Linespotting this is my fourth pregnancy, I’ve had spotting in 3/4 of them (one successful, one MMC, and now this new pregnancy). The spotting I have now is exactly as you describe, and I was told it’s caused because pregnancy makes your cervix sensitive. I would suggest getting in touch with your GP next week and asking for a referral to your local EPU who may do a scan to check everything is as it should be. If you’ve had a loss before they should prescribe progesterone, but might not if not. Otherwise, the advice is typically to stay hydrated and eat a fibre rich diet to make your BMs easier (especially important as pregnancy vitamins that have added iron can contribute to constipation too!)
